How to convert internship into full-time-role?
Hi,
I will be doing an off-cycle internship starting in February. According to the interviews I was in, the firm offers approx. 20% of interns a full-time offer. Given that they only offer full-time-roles for only such a small percentage I wanted to ask you what, in your opinion, is the most crucial thing you are looking for.
Aside from delivering my work on time with as few mistakes a possible, is there any other way to positively stand out? Also, do you look for interns who are eagerly motivated and that come up to asking for work or do you prefer that you approach the intern. Also is it good if I ask you various things like "what other projects are you working on", "how can I improve" etc, or do you prefer being leaved alone since your work is stressful enough as is?
